A pipettor is a pipettor’s helper, which assists in liquid samples transfer. It has numerous benefits such as minimizing the likelihood of contamination, making it easy for use over long working hours by reducing hand fatigue and stress. A researcher will have more accurate and precise liquid manipulation when using a pipette and this will guarantee dependable results in different laboratory applications. In fact these come in various sizes as well as types, usually having an elongated tube with a sharp end that uses some devices – either a plunger or a valve – to pull in or get out fluids.
Application: Pasteur pipettes have common usage in the transport of small volumes of substances within laboratories either biological or chemical laboratories.
Application: Serological pipettes are typically employed when measuring or transferring relatively large volumes, usually in milliliter (mL) range, of fluids.
Application: For purposes of measuring one specific amount of contents, volumetric pipettes have been made.
In order to have accurate and reliable data in laboratory experiments, it essential to regularly calibrate and maintain them properly. Moreover, correct methods of pipetting should be followed while using suitable type of pipettor in each application for getting precise and reproducible outcomes.
